分布式系统故障定位的故障处理团队建设?

在当今信息化时代,分布式系统已成为企业业务运行的重要支撑。然而,随着系统规模的不断扩大和复杂性的增加,分布式系统故障的定位和解决变得愈发困难。为了提高故障处理效率,建设一支高效的故障处理团队至关重要。本文将围绕分布式系统故障定位的故障处理团队建设展开讨论,旨在为相关企业提供有益的参考。

一、分布式系统故障定位的重要性

分布式系统具有高可用性、高性能和可扩展性等优点,但在实际运行过程中,故障仍然不可避免。分布式系统故障的快速定位和解决,对于保障企业业务的连续性和稳定性具有重要意义。

  1. 降低故障处理时间:通过高效的故障处理团队,可以迅速定位故障原因,缩短故障处理时间,降低业务中断风险。

  2. 提高故障处理效率:专业的故障处理团队具备丰富的经验和技能,能够快速解决复杂故障,提高故障处理效率。

  3. 降低故障成本:及时解决故障可以避免因故障导致的业务损失,降低故障成本。

二、故障处理团队建设的关键要素

  1. 人才选拔与培养:组建一支高效的故障处理团队,首先要注重人才的选拔与培养。

    • 选拔标准:具备扎实的计算机基础知识、熟悉分布式系统架构、具备良好的沟通能力和团队合作精神。
    • 培养方式:通过内部培训、外部学习、项目实战等方式,提升团队成员的专业技能和综合素质。
  2. 团队协作与沟通:故障处理团队需要具备良好的协作与沟通能力。

    • 明确分工:根据团队成员的特长和技能,合理分配任务,确保团队高效运作。
    • 定期沟通:通过团队会议、邮件、即时通讯工具等方式,保持团队成员之间的信息畅通。
  3. 故障处理流程与规范:建立完善的故障处理流程和规范,确保故障处理工作的有序进行。

    • 故障报告:明确故障报告的格式、内容要求,确保故障信息的完整性。
    • 故障分析:制定故障分析流程,明确故障分析的方法和步骤。
    • 故障解决:制定故障解决策略,确保故障得到及时解决。
  4. 技术支持与工具:为故障处理团队提供必要的技术支持和工具,提高故障处理效率。

    • 监控工具:实时监控分布式系统运行状态,及时发现潜在故障。
    • 日志分析工具:对系统日志进行分析,快速定位故障原因。
    • 自动化工具:利用自动化工具,提高故障处理效率。

三、案例分析

以某大型电商平台为例,该平台采用分布式架构,业务量巨大。在业务高峰期,平台出现了一次严重的故障,导致大量用户无法正常访问。平台故障处理团队迅速响应,通过以下步骤解决了故障:

  1. 故障报告:故障处理团队接到故障报告后,立即启动应急预案,明确故障影响范围和严重程度。

  2. 故障分析:通过日志分析工具,定位故障原因,发现是某台服务器内存泄漏导致的。

  3. 故障解决:故障处理团队立即采取措施,隔离故障服务器,释放内存,恢复正常业务。

  4. 总结与改进:故障处理团队对此次故障进行总结,分析故障原因,制定预防措施,避免类似故障再次发生。

四、总结

分布式系统故障定位的故障处理团队建设是企业保障业务连续性和稳定性的重要环节。通过人才选拔与培养、团队协作与沟通、故障处理流程与规范、技术支持与工具等方面的建设,可以有效提高故障处理效率,降低故障成本。企业应根据自身实际情况,不断优化故障处理团队建设,为企业的发展保驾护航。

猜你喜欢:网络流量分发